Standards manual pallet racks

Today, almost every country has its own standards of operation of pallet racking and shelving equipment manufacturers association (for example, in the UK it is SEMA). More than 10 years ago, the Federation of European manufacturers (shelf equipment department) recommended the use of standards for the design and operation of the racks. Pallet racking FEM 10.2.02. – Standard design and FEM 10.3.01 – tolerance components.

In Russia, production and operation of pallet racks regulate the following standards:
– GOST 14757_81 Ctellazhi collapsible. Types, basic parameters and dimensions (with a change in N 1, 2) – Resolution of the State Standard of the USSR from 10.07.1981 N 3323
– Standard of 10.07.1981 N 14757-81;
– GOST 16140_77 Shelves collapsible. Specifications of the USSR State Standard Resolution dated 28.10.1977 N 2528 GOST from 28.10.1977 N 16140-77;
– GOST 28766_90 Racks. Bases of calculation – Resolution of the State Standard of the USSR from 03.12.1990 N 3007 GOST from 03.12.1990 N 28766-90.

However, the listed standards do not apply to special purpose racks. This means that the production and supply of pallet racks can be carried out on the basis of its own technical conditions, without complying with the requirements of the above regulations.

Here is the GOST 16140-77 for the production and operation of the collapsible shelves.

1. Types, basic parameters and dimensions

1.1. Types, basic parameters and dimensions of racks – according to GOST 14757-81.

2. TECHNICAL REQUIREMENTS

2.1. Shelves should be constructed in accordance with the requirements of the standard working drawings approved in due course.

2.2. The design of the racks must be capable of use in mechanized warehouses.

2.3. Mechanical properties of materials parts and assembly units shelves should allow the perception of loads, provided GOST 14757-81, taking into account the conditions of use of racks.

2.4. The curvature of the uprights and shelves assembled beams must be less than 3 mm at 1000 mm length and 0.1% of the total length (see. Fig. 1).

2.5. Twisting uprights and beams about their longitudinal axis should not be greater than 0.5 mm by 1000 mm long, and 0.05% of the total dyne (see. Fig. 2).

2.6. On the surfaces of shelving parts are not allowed cracks, slivers, laminations, sunsets and burrs.

2.7. roughness parameters according to GOST 2789-73 processed metal surfaces should be Ra? 50 microns.

(Changed edition, Change. Number 1).

2.8. Types of structural members and welds – in accordance with GOST 8713-79, GOST 5264-80, GOST 11533-75, GOST 11534-75, GOST 14771-76.

Places to be welded must be cleaned of dirt, oil, scale and corrosion.

2.9. The seams welded joints are not permitted:

lack of penetration;

Local nodules;

slag inclusions and pores with diameters greater than 1 mm;

undercuts of the base metal of more than 0.5 mm;

fracture of all kinds.

2.10. Dimensions of parts and assembly units of racks should be performed not permissible deviations rougher quality class 14 according to GOST 25347-82.

2.11. shelving frame is allowed to produce two or more detachable parts in height.

2.12. The surface of the racks must be primed and painted in gray or silver color.

Paints and coatings must meet appearance Class V GOST 9.032-74, operating conditions – the group U2 GOST 9.104-79.

Allowed by agreement with the customer to produce racks only primed.

Fasteners should have a protective coating according to GOST 9.306-85.

(Changed edition, Change. Number 1).

2.13. Perpendicularity shelving uprights assembled should not be more than 1 mm without load to horizontal shelves 1000 mm in length, and under the influence of the horizontal load should not be more than 4 mm at 1000 mm length and 6 mm length.

Perpendicularity reference cell surface to the posts of the rack without load should not be more than 5 mm by 1000 mm in length. 2.14. Shelves should be tested for strength and stability of the action of the vertical and horizontal loads.

3. SAFETY REQUIREMENTS

3.1. The design of the racks and the details of their attachment should provide stiffness, strength, stability, safety and ease of installation and maintenance. Elements racks should not have sharp corners, edges and surfaces with irregularities.

3.2. Shelves should have a protective earth in accordance with GOST 12.2.007.0-75.

4. PACKAGE

4.1. The kit should include shelving components and assembly units, the number of which is indicated on the design drawings.

4.2. Each rack must be accompanied by instructions for installation and operation, as well as a passport in accordance with GOST 2.601-68.

5. ACCEPTANCE OF TERMS

5.1. To verify compliance with the requirements of this standard shelving the manufacturer must carry out acceptance testing and periodic testing.

5.2. At the acceptance tests for compliance with the requirements of paragraphs. 2.1-2.14 should be checked assembly units in the details of each type of shelving, taken at random in the quantity required for the assembly of three-section of the stack.

5.3. Periodic tests for compliance with the requirements of paragraphs. 2.1-2.14 should be carried out once a year. The periodic tests are subjected to assembly units and details of each type of shelving, taken at random in the quantity required for the assembly of three-section of the stack and passed acceptance tests.

5.4. The results of acceptance tests reflect a passport on a rack.

periodic test results registered in the minutes in accordance with GOST 15.001-88.

6. TEST METHODS

6.1. The quality of the protective coating materials and surfaces of parts racks (Nos. 2.6 and 2.12) is checked by inspection.

6.2. The quality of welded joints (Nos. 2.8 and 2.9) is checked according to GOST 3242-79.

6.3. When testing the strength and stability of the vertical and horizontal loads (para. 2.14) rack, which has all the elements provided for working drawings, collected from three sections and is subjected to, the effects of static loads. shelving support should have a rigid connection to the base secured to the floor.

6.4. When the vertical load test (see. Fig. 3, 4) to each cell stack through rigid beams length in applied load

2qB = 1,25Q,

where q – the intensity of the load distribution;

Q – permissible load cell in accordance with GOST 14757-81.

The load on the rack – 1,25 Qn, where n – the number of cells in the stack.

Load Duration – 10 min.

After removing the vertical load produced horizontal static load test (see. Fig. 5, 6). At point B / H 2 at a height of one shelf end sections via a fixed length timber V is applied for 10 minutes in a horizontal load of P = Q / 2

Then measure the perpendicularity rack shelf to the horizontal plane and the load P is removed. Thereafter, through a rigid beam length L for 10 min load P applied at the point L / 2 of the same section, measured perpendicularity racks rack sections to the horizontal plane P and the load is removed.

6.5. After the tests, the influence of the vertical and horizontal rack load must meet the requirements of para. 2.13. Seams welded joints – the requirements of clause 2.9.. Details of the rack must not be damaged and residual strain.

7. MARKING, PACKING, TRANSPORTATION AND STORAGE

7.1. In a prominent place of the first frame plate racks should be installed in accordance with GOST 12970-67 and GOST 12971-67, comprising:

trademark of the manufacturer;

type rack;

the size of the rack of the cell in the plan;

load capacity, and the cell section;

the date of issue.

7.2. rack frames should be securely stowed in the pack, fasteners – plank in boxes in accordance with GOST 16536-84 and GOST 15623-84. Each pack or box should contain the details and assembly units of the stack of the same type and size.

7.3. Gross Weight pack – not more than 5 m.

7.4. Bundles must be securely tied in the transverse direction of the wire or ribbon in at least two places, ensuring the safety of packs of spillage and safety parts and assembly units of the deformation in the field of dressings. Mounting packs should guarantee sustainable transportation and storage.

Each pack and box attached a label indicating a trademark of manufacturer, a symbol, the number of parts and assembly units of the rack, gross mass.

7.5. In packaging of parts sent to one customer, one box is embedded documentation in accordance with the requirements of Sec. 4.2.

7.6. Marking of packages – according to GOST 14192-77.

7.7. Transportation, storage of parts and assembly units of racks – on a group conditions of storage Æ1 GOST 15150-69.

During storage and transportation of parts and assembly units of racks should have no impact loads, leading to permanent deformation.

8. OPERATING INSTRUCTIONS

8.1. Shelves on site must be installed in accordance with the instructions for installation and operating instructions.

8.2. Racks should be installed on flat ground with a hard surface, a slope with a view of flatness 0.002.

8.3. With a view to checking the technical condition and compliance with the requirements of this standard racks on site must be inspected and tested static load in accordance with the requirements of operational documentation.

9. WARRANTY

9.1. The manufacturer shall ensure compliance with the requirements of this standard racks subject to exploitation, transportation and storage.

9.2. Warranty period – 24 months. from the date of entry into operation of the stack. (Changed edition, Change. Number 1).
